"Bingham, Jay" <Jay.Bingham@hp.com> wrote:

> I have just one question about C-x C-j, what function does it invoke
> on your machine.

It runs `dired-jump' iff you have loaded the dired-x library.

> I am running 21.1 on Win2000 and 20.4 on a Unix box, it is undefined
> in both of these.

(require 'dired-x) in your .emacs should define it.
